Video: Canadian Firefighters Injured in Massive House Blast

Raw video from the scene captured the burning home's explosion, which sent three Scugog firefighters to the hospital with "minor injuries," according to the township.
June 10, 2020

Three Canadian firefighters were injured following a massive home explosion Tuesday.

Firefighters responded to a house fire in Scugog, a township in Ontario, shortly after 10 a.m., DurhamRegion.com reports. As fire crews and police were assessing the scene, the burning house exploded.

Video from the scene shows a fireball erupting from the structure and sending emergency workers running. The explosion can be seen at the 0:30 mark.

Three Scugog firefighters were taken to the hospital for possible injuries. In a social media update, the township said the firefighters were "being assessed for what is believed to be minor injuries."

Officials believe the explosion was caused by propane and oxygen tanks, according to DurhamRegion.com. No one was home at the time of the fire and explosion.
